From 8b8fa24fec8b669b23ca060b2d5d968af341947e Mon Sep 17 00:00:00 2001 From: Subv Date: Sun, 5 Aug 2012 21:52:36 -0500 Subject: Core/PacketIO: Enabled another bunch of opcodes and made some misc fixes here and there --- src/server/game/Entities/Player/Player.cpp | 2 +- src/server/game/Entities/Unit/StatSystem.cpp | 2 -- 2 files changed, 1 insertion(+), 3 deletions(-) (limited to 'src/server/game/Entities') diff --git a/src/server/game/Entities/Player/Player.cpp b/src/server/game/Entities/Player/Player.cpp index 9a6a6405a55..942403065ae 100755 --- a/src/server/game/Entities/Player/Player.cpp +++ b/src/server/game/Entities/Player/Player.cpp @@ -4483,7 +4483,7 @@ bool Player::ResetTalents(bool no_cost) if (!no_cost) { - ModifyMoney(-(int32)cost); + ModifyMoney(-(int64)cost); UpdateAchievementCriteria(ACHIEVEMENT_CRITERIA_TYPE_GOLD_SPENT_FOR_TALENTS, cost); UpdateAchievementCriteria(ACHIEVEMENT_CRITERIA_TYPE_NUMBER_OF_TALENT_RESETS, 1); diff --git a/src/server/game/Entities/Unit/StatSystem.cpp b/src/server/game/Entities/Unit/StatSystem.cpp index c307324bead..4bc33dd10f1 100755 --- a/src/server/game/Entities/Unit/StatSystem.cpp +++ b/src/server/game/Entities/Unit/StatSystem.cpp @@ -800,9 +800,7 @@ void Player::UpdateManaRegen() // Get bonus from SPELL_AURA_MOD_MANA_REGEN_FROM_STAT aura AuraEffectList const& regenAura = GetAuraEffectsByType(SPELL_AURA_MOD_MANA_REGEN_FROM_STAT); for (AuraEffectList::const_iterator i = regenAura.begin(); i != regenAura.end(); ++i) - { power_regen_mp5 += GetStat(Stats((*i)->GetMiscValue())) * (*i)->GetAmount() / 500.0f; - } // Set regen rate in cast state apply only on spirit based regen int32 modManaRegenInterrupt = GetTotalAuraModifier(SPELL_AURA_MOD_MANA_REGEN_INTERRUPT); -- cgit v1.2.3